Yes, it is appropriate, and it is wonderful!
I am a home share host, and I have stayed all over the world with home share hosts.
Not only does it make for a richer experience for guests, it all but guarantees that house rules will not be broken. In fact, my permit to host requires me to be present at all times when guests are here. Definitely hassle free and stress free hosting.
Safety issues are taken care of. We are in California too - earthquakes, weather and fires are a reality. Who is better qualified to take care of our guests in one of these situations than we are?
Home share guests are respectful and it is great fun to really share with them!
Definitely go for it, and let us know how you like it.

@Eileen462 Absolutely yes. It is the original Airbnb concept and is sought out by certain types of guest.
You listing however is set up slightly wrong as it says 2 bedroom but the where I will sleep section only has the one bedroom. Always preview the listing to see what guests see and then correct the issues you will find.
